Henry fresh outta shed
Funny cuz it seems like these days all my bts are getting on the same shed cycle as they all shed for me over the last week, Henry here shedding about 2 days ago. I just love when she sheds, she's so bright and red and contrasting. Just love the colors. She was produced by Sweet Arrow Reptiles in 2013 and was a year old on May 31st. I had originally thought male but have started leaning female and was told recently that my suspicions might be right. Either way, Henry is just an awesome northern and sweet as can be.
